description Taeniopoda eques Overview
Taeniopoda eques, commonly known as the horse lubber grasshopper, is a large acridid grasshopper native to North America. Its distinctive black and orange coloration serves as an aposematic warning signal indicating chemical defenses against predators. This species is notable for its size and striking appearance and is of interest to entomologists studying insect defense mechanisms and regional biodiversity within the Romaleinae subfamily.

What is the horse lubber grasshopper and where is it found?
Taeniopoda eques, commonly known as the horse lubber grasshopper, is a large grasshopper species native to the southwestern United States and Mexico. It is commonly encountered in Arizona, New Mexico, and Texas, as well as in northern Mexican states, favoring desert scrub and grassland habitats.
Why is the horse lubber grasshopper black and orange?
The bold black and orange coloration of Taeniopoda eques is aposematic, meaning it serves as a warning signal to potential predators that the insect contains chemical defenses. When threatened, the grasshopper can secrete a frothy toxic substance from specialized glands, reinforcing the visual warning.
Are horse lubber grasshoppers dangerous to humans or pets?
While Taeniopoda eques produces chemical defenses that are toxic to birds and small predators that consume it, they are not dangerous to humans through casual contact. However, pet owners should discourage dogs or cats from eating them, as the defensive compounds can cause gastrointestinal distress.
How large do horse lubber grasshoppers get?
Taeniopoda eques is one of the larger grasshopper species in North America, with adults reaching approximately 5 to 7 centimeters in length. Their substantial size combined with their striking coloration makes them one of the most visually conspicuous insects in the American Southwest.
